COOLING SYSTEM
SYSTEM TESTING
COOLANT
Remove the front cover lid by removing the trim clip screw.
Test the coolant mixture with an antifreeze tester.
For maximum corrosion protection, a 50- 50% solution of
ethylene glycol and distilled water is recommended.
INSPECTION
Wet the cap sealing surface and pressure test the radiator cap.
Replace the radiator cap if it does not hold pressure, or if relief
pressure is too high or too low. It must hold specified pressure
for at least six seconds.
RADIATOR CAP RELIEF PRESSURE:
15-105 kPa (0.15-1.05

COOLANT REPLACEMENT

• The engine must be cool be/ore
ser~'icing
the cooling system, or
severe scalding
may
result.
Unscrew the trim clip screw and remove the trim clip.
Slide the front cover lid to the
side and remove the
front cover lid.
Remove the radiator cap.
